I need fonts
What fonts should I install and/or how do I install fonts I have from windows?

download the fonts u want from internet or put the existing from ur windows system to a disk.then go to
/us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ts and put them there(ttf format).this is the path for suse distro,don't know if changes with other versions...that's it!Linux For Ever!
